Where in the world is Wet'n'Wild Water World?
Wet'n'Wild Water World is located on the Gold Coast in the south east corner of the Australian state of Queensland.
The Gold Coast is a very popular holiday destination for Australians and overseas travellers alike.
Its attractions include some of the world's safest and most beautiful beaches, international standard accommodation, world class shopping and dining, and a picturesque hinterland. It is also Australia's theme park capital, home to Sea World, Sea World Resort & Water Park, Warner Bros. Movie World, Wet 'n' Wild Water World, Australian Outback Spectacular and Paradise Country.
The Gold Coast is accessible by road, rail and air. It has its own International and Domestic Airport, with Brisbane International and Domestic Airports approximately one hour drive to the north.
When is Wet'n'Wild Water World open?
Wet'n'Wild Water World is open every day of the year except Christmas Day on 25 December and ANZAC Day on 25 April. Wet'n'Wild is closed on these days.
The park opens at 10:00am every day and closing times vary throughout the year. For additional information see the Park Hours.

What is the weather like?
The Gold Coast has a delightful subtropical climate. The average daytime temperature during Spring and Summer (September to February) is 28 degrees Celsius. The average temperature in Winter (June to August) is a very mild 21 degrees Celsius.
The Gold Coast averages almost 300 days of sunshine per year!
Is it cold during Winter?
Between May and August, Wet'n'Wild Water World features heated pools and slides. The water is generally heated to a comfortable temperature and, combined with the Gold Coast's famously mild Winter weather, it's the perfect place to make a splash all year round.

Who is eligible for a Pensioner discount?
To qualify for reduced admission entry as a Pensioner, one of the following criteria must be met.
- Holders of a valid Australian Government issued Pension Concession Card (PPC), including listed dependants will qualify for the pension rate. This does not include holders of Australian Health Care Cards. The Australian Pension Concession Card is issued to recipients of the following pension payments:
- Sole Parenting Pension
- Mature Aged Pension
- Disability Pension
- Holders of valid New Zealand Government issued Superannuation Card (SC). The card holder and listed dependants will qualify for the pension rate.
- Holders of a valid Australian Government issued Seniors Card.
- Holders of a valid New Zealand Seniors Card.
- Holders of a valid Australian Government issued Veteran Affairs Pension Card.
- Any person 65 years of age or older - proof of age is required.
- Disabled rates are available for purchase at the ticket booths only on the day of your visit upon the presentation of a State or Commonwealth authority's Disability Pension card. A carer accompanying a disabled guest for the sole purpose of assisting that guest will be admitted free of charge providing a current Carer's Card (or similar) issued only by relevant State or Commonwealth authorities is produced.
What do I do about looking after valuables while at the park?
Wet'n'Wild Water World has electronic security lockers available for hire.
A standard size locker is $9.00 for the day and can be accessed as many times as you like and a limited number of larger size lockers are available but are reserved for guests to store luggage. Cost is $12.00 for the day.
What is Splash Cash?
Splash Cash is the most convenient'n'clever way to carry your cash...without actually carrying your cash!
You simply credit a waterproof wristband with whatever amount you choose. You can slide'n'swim while wearing your wristband and then come time to buy lunch or a souvenir you just swipe your wristband to pay! The money is automatically deducted from the wristband just like your bank account.
That means you don't have to keep returning to your locker to grab some cash which means more time on the awesome attractions!
And at the end of the day you download the remaining cash back into your pocket. It's that easy!
Splash Cash is so innovative that it also recognises you when our Ride Photography takes your pic! You can swipe your wristband at the Photo Centre and it will bring up all of your photos from throughout the day. How cool is that!

Can I wear a t-shirt on the slides?
You are welcome to wear whatever swimwear you're comfortable in while using the slides and pools and Wet'n'Wild.
While riding the Twister some people find that not wearing a t-shirt allows you to slide at a greater speed. T-shirts do not affect speeds on other attractions.
Wet'n'Wild Water World supports safe fun in the sun, so no matter what swimwear you choose wear remember to wear a hat while out of the water and to reapply your sunscreen every two hours.

How much does it cost to hire a Stroller or Wheelchair?
Stroller Hire and Wheelchair Hire is available from the Guest Services Office.
The hire charge for Strollers is $10.00 plus a refundable $10.00 deposit which you will receive back upon safe return of the Stroller.
Wheelchairs are available complimentary however we do require a $20.00 refundable deposit which you will receive back upon safe return of the Wheelchair.
A form of ID will be required. A limited number of Wheelchairs are available so we recommend you prebook with Guest Services. Hire fee is per day or part thereof. All charges are GST inclusive.

Can we bring a picnic into the park?
You are allowed to bring a picnic lunch into Wet'n'Wild Water World however, no commercially prepared food or alcohol can be brought into the park. Due to safety regulations, glassware of any kind is also prohibited. Coin operated Barbecue facilities are available as well as plenty of shady retreats to enjoy your lunch.
Do you offer an Industry Discount?
Industry discounts are available to select Industry employees upon meeting certain criteria. Licensed AFTA or TAANZ travel agents are entitled to a 50% discount off the normal admission price. The discount is applicable to the travel agent only and can be obtained by presenting a business card with photographic ID at the theme park ticket booths.
For all other Industry rate requests please apply online here. If your request is approved, you will need to show proof of employment (a business card or letter from employer) plus photographic ID at the theme park ticket booths.
